Olympus SP-800UZ or Nikon Coolpix P100? What is the better choice?

Can anybody give me a useful hint concerning the two cameras? The technical details I already know, but has anybody experience with these two? There is something that still keeps me from buying the Nikon P100: Apart from some really convincingly good tests some people stress that the Zoom sometimes freezes or the fotos are somewhat mediocre. The Olympus has much better critics but doesn´t have audio with the video. Alright, I know the Zoom function is not a must since there are also videocameras specialised in this field available, and there is no camera available in this price spectrum that has all functions but can anybody recommend me one of these two cameras? And if, why? Many people keep telling that either Nikon or Canon are the ones to go for but the Olympus might also be worth thinking about it…….

I’ve been using the P90 for about 7 months & haven’t had one problem with it. The P100 is a tad better than
the P90. The zoom works great. I’ve taken photos of airplanes in flight that turned out sharp. Even a pic of the full moon !
You don’t have full use of the zoom when you shoot a video. And with the P90, you’re limited to 25 minutes shooting time. These are bridge cameras & their main function is to shoot stills.
